(8,352 posts)63. I adore 80's arcade MAME games.
My solution was to soft-mod the original Xbox. I then use the emulators MAMAoX and CoinOPS to play every, and I do mean every, arcade game in existence.
An original Xbox can be had for $30.00. Softmodding is easy and very safe. Instructions are all over the internet. If you PM me, I can even put you in touch with a guy who has a little kit for $20.00. Then I got an Xbox to PS2 adapter. I use a "PELICAN PL631 PS2 Arcade Fighter Fully Analog Joystick" which costs about $25.00. Having a real arcade analog joystick really helps with games like Star Wars and all the fighters and SHMUPS.
Plus playing them in 720p through composite on my 32" HDTV with speakers is a blast!
